Description

Explore the world of acting, escape into other characters, build performance and presentation skills and play a little! Acting class will broaden your horizons with scene work and improv exercises designed to ignite your creativity and grow confidence in a new way. The class will explore the basics of acting technique focusing on communication, authenticity, physicality, humor, vulnerability, and passion. The class is open to high school students and above. Very little experience is necessary. Bring yourselves and a sense of openness.

Julie Fitzpatrick is an accomplished actor, writer, and teaching artist whose work spans Off-Broadway, Off-Off Broadway, regional theater, and film/television. She has performed with companies including Ensemble Studio Theatre, Ma-Yi Theater Company, The Playwrights Realm, and TheatreWorks Silicon Valley, among many others. More recently, she has appeared with Moses Gunn Play Company, Legacy Theatre, and GreenStage Guilford.

Her screen credits include appearances on Law & Order and The OA, as well as several independent film projects. Julie holds a BA from the University of Pennsylvania and an MFA from the American Conservatory Theater.

In addition to acting, Julie is an active writer and educator. Her solo play *77 U-Turn* is published by Next Stage Press, and her poetry collection *Church on the Screen: A Sunday Series of Pandemic Poetry* is available through Breakwater Books. She is a member of the Guilford Poets’ Guild, the Connecticut Theatre Women Network, and Ensemble Studio Theatre.

A dedicated teaching artist, Julie has taught and directed with numerous schools and arts organizations across Connecticut. She currently teaches acting and solo performance, continuing her commitment to mentoring emerging artists. She lives in Connecticut with her husband and their three sons.
